I set a goal of 16 weeks for 20 pounds and hit 21 pounds instead! Ecstatic! This is the lowest weight I've been in about 20 years, despite numerous diets. I'm finally back below 140. This time I used MFP. I had tried tracking calories other ways, on paper, but it was so too, too time consuming. MFP was, for me, really helpful.

My story is one of woman-kind I think.. I am a young-ish grandmother who, even as a teen, had a soft waistline unsuited to bikini's. After three babies, for me the weight built up around my belly, my hips and my midsection in general, generating the choice of clothes that always disguised my waist but tended to look baggy. I yo-yo'd between diet and just not paying attention. Lost a lot of weight during my divorce years back. Sure liked it but I'd done nothing but get depressed to do it, so it all came back.

I grew up with a mother who did not encourage her daughters to exercise. I have had to learn its benefits through raising my own daughters and over a long long time, learning to include exercise in my life. I am still learning and have to work at it to make sure it is routine in my life..

In my more recent era of dieting, I have paid a lot of attention to learning about the food I eat and how my body responds to food and exercise. A HRM was a great tool for me, showing me how much work it takes to produce significant calorie burn in my body. It has also been a delight to see my body's efficiency improve...albeit lowering calorie burn so that I had to change my routines..

Now the next chapter MUSTstart and it is a new one for me. I want to make this weight loss permanent!!!! I want to use my exercise to maintain aerobically, for shape up and work on some miscellaneous needs of my body. Fortunately I am in very good health by all medical measures.

My life is mine to master. I'd love to have some maintenance buddies. Any out there?
